New Pokemon Legends: Arceus & Diamond/Pearl Remake Trailers Are Out In The Wild

The Pokémon Company and developer Game Freak have released new information and trailers for their upcoming Pokémon games: Pokémon Legends: Arceus and Pokémon Brilliant Diamond/Shining Pearl.

Pokemon Legends: Arceus

The new trailer showcases the game’s Arc Phone, Alpha Pokémon (uber Pokémon you can fight & tame), rideable Pokemon, and Jubilife Village (your home base). It’s definitely shaping up to be the open-world RPG Pokémon fans always wanted since they’ve been stuck with the same kind of game for 20+ years.

Pokemon Legends: Arceus will be out on 28th January, 2022.

Pokemon Brilliant Diamond/Shining Pearl

Speaking of the same f***ing game for 20+ years, we have the Nintendo Switch remakes of the Nintendo DS mothership Pokemon games. At the very least, this remake is adding new improvements to existing mechanics, while also looking cute.

The remakes will be out on 19th November.
